Audi Builds Firm Foundations For UK Q3 Launch

The new Audi Q3 compact SUV is in good shape to take on the UK following the confirmation this week of keen pricing starting from £24,560 OTR, and the finalization of an impressive equipment list for all versions. Orders for the third Q-model in the series, which will have the distinction of being the first Audi SUV to offer the efficiency-focused option of a 54.3mpg front-wheel-drive variant, are set to begin in June. Deliveries will start in November.
Four engines will initially be available, all combining direct fuel injection with turbo charging and all backed up by start-stop and energy recuperation systems - the 2.0-litre TFSI petrol unit in 170PS and 211PS forms and the 2.0-litre TDI with 140PS and 177PS. The 2.0-litre TDI 140PS unit will power the front-wheel-drive model only at launch, deliveries of which will start in December, shortly after the rest of the range.

All other engines will be linked to quattro all-wheel-drive, but regardless of the configuration secure handling will be assured by the sophisticated Electronic Stability Program with electronic differential lock, which effectively regulates torque distribution by braking individual wheels when they start to slip.

New efficiency feature for S tronic
The 2.0 TDI 140PS and 2.0 TFSI 170PS engines will be linked to a six-speed manual transmission as standard, while the 2.0 TDI 177PS and 2.0 TFSI 211PS units will feature a new development of the acclaimed seven-speed S tronic transmission. If the optional Audi drive select adaptive dynamics system with its new efficiency mode is specified, the rapid-shifting twin-clutch transmission will now disengage its active clutch each time the driver lifts off the throttle, allowing the Q3 to use the momentum already built up to ‘coast’ without the need for engine input. When the efficiency mode is selected, the electronic climate control and cruise control systems also operate at the optimum level for minimal fuel consumption.

Inside the deceptively roomy Q3 there is seating for up to five adults, an accommodating load bay offering up to 1,365 litres of capacity thanks to split/folding rear seats, and an impressive level of standard equipment across the SE and S line specification levels.

Externally the SE option includes 17-inch alloy wheels, contrasting exterior trim, chrome window trims, aluminium roof rails and rear parking sensors, and inside dual-zone climate control, a Concert audio system with 6.5-inch manually retractable colour display screen, Bluetooth interface, Audi Music Interface iPod connection and light and rain sensors. The Q3 will also come equipped with navigation preparation, enabling customers to ‘activate’ navigation retrospectively by purchasing an SD card if required.

For a premium of £2,750 in each case, the new Audi Q3 can be upgraded to the S line specification, which includes 18-inch alloy wheels, S line exterior and interior styling enhancements, and xenon headlamps with LED daytime running lamps and LED rear tail lights.

Options include ‘steerable beam’ adaptive light technology for the xenon plus headlights, a high-beam assistant to intelligently illuminate the road ahead, the hard drive-based navigation system plus with seven-inch colour screen and 3D mapping and the side assist blind spot warning and lane assist lane departure warning driver aids.

Among the more practical extras is a luggage compartment package, a front-passenger seat with a folding seat back, a reversible loadliner, a reversible mat, a load sill protector made of stainless steel, a load-through hatch in the rear seat backrest and a ski bag.

Pricing

SE model pricing

Engines Drive Power Transmission Recommended OTR
2.0TDI front 140PS 6-speed Manual £24,560.00
2.0TDI quattro 177PS 7-speed S tronic £28,460.00
2.0TFSI quattro 170PS 6-speed Manual £25,690.00
2.0TFSI quattro 211PS 7-speed S tronic £28,610.00

S line model pricing

Engines Drive Power Transmission Recommended OTR
2.0TDI front 140PS 6-speed Manual £27,310.00
2.0TDI quattro 177PS 7-speed S tronic £31,210.00
2.0TFSI quattro 170PS 6-speed Manual £28,440.00
2.0TFSI quattro 211PS 7-speed S tronic £31,360.00
